Regeneron (REGN) Dips More Than Broader Markets: What You Should Know

Regeneron (REGN - Free Report) closed the most recent trading day at $544.10, moving -0.75% from the previous trading session. This change lagged the S&P 500's 0.15% loss on the day. Elsewhere, the Dow lost 0.07%, while the tech-heavy Nasdaq lost 0.07%.

Investors will be hoping for strength from REGN as it approaches its next earnings release, which is expected to be February 5, 2021. The company is expected to report EPS of $8.32, up 10.93% from the prior-year quarter. Meanwhile, our latest consensus estimate is calling for revenue of $2.39 billion, up 10.08% from the prior-year quarter.

Within the past 30 days, our consensus EPS projection remained stagnant. REGN is holding a Zacks Rank of #4 (Sell) right now.

Valuation is also important, so investors should note that REGN has a Forward P/E ratio of 14.23 right now. This valuation marks a discount compared to its industry's average Forward P/E of 30.99.

Investors should also note that REGN has a PEG ratio of 0.78 right now. This popular metric is similar to the widely-known P/E ratio, with the difference being that the PEG ratio also takes into account the company's expected earnings growth rate. The Medical - Biomedical and Genetics industry currently had an average PEG ratio of 1.24 as of yesterday's close.

The Medical - Biomedical and Genetics industry is part of the Medical sector. This group has a Zacks Industry Rank of 223, putting it in the bottom 13% of all 250+ industries.
